If you prefer to keep your trap door hidden and discreet, there are plenty of options to choose from in our assortment of flush hinges. One of the main advantages of flush hinges is that they lie completely flat. Once installed, they provide a smooth surface, without an obstructive hinge pin. These recessed hinges can be used for a variety of applications including trap doors and butler trays.

Our classic ring pull is made from marine-grade 316 stainless steel to ensure maximum corrosion resistance in coastal areas and other harsh environments. The ring pivots out, so you can easily grab onto the pull and then return it to its flush position when the pull is not in use. This ring pull can also be used for doors, dock boxes, or anywhere a recessed installation is desired. We carry a brass flush ring pull that is designed to be mortised into the door, so that it sits completely flush with the surface of the door. Double Acting: Double acting hinges swing in both directions.
Ball Bearing: Ball bearing hinges have ball bearings to act as a buffer between the knuckles. They tend to be quieter and more durable than plain bearing hinges. They are recommended for heavy doors and doors fitted with closers.
Roller Bearing: Roller bearings are able to support very heavy loads. Many of our heavy duty gate hinges are equipped with roller bearings.
Frameless: Frameless cabinets do not have a face-frame, and instead rely on thicker side panels for strength. Frameless cabinets are very common in Europe, but have steadily been making their way into America, as they lend themselves well to contemporary and modern designs.


Radius Corner: Radius corners are typically only available on residential grade hinges. Corners are mortised using a router.

Double Demountable: Requires a slot be cut into the door and the cabinet frame.
